基于Web的数控机床误差参数辨识系统

摘    要:误差参数辨识是误差补偿的前提。本文首先介绍了误差辨识的原理,然后采用B/S模式、3层体系结构和.NetRe-moting技术设计并实现了基于Web的误差参数辨识系统。通过实例运行,证明该系统的设计是可行的,从而为实现基于Web的误差补偿技术奠定基础。

Abstract:Error compensation technology is based on error mea-surement and evaluation. The paper introduces the principle oferror measurement and evaluation at first. Using B/S structure,3- Tier structure and .Net Remoting, the paper design the wholeframework of the web- based application of three- axis CNC errormeasurement and evaluation and realize it by c# language. Ex-periments show that the design is practical. The application pre-pares well ready for the web- based application of error compen-sation.
